Abstract

The invention relates to an intelligent polishing machine based on an internet of things. The intelligent polishing machine comprises a base, a lifting mechanism, a swing mechanism, a polishing mechanism and a center control mechanism, wherein the lifting mechanism, the swing mechanism and the polishing mechanism are electrically connected with the center control mechanism; the lifting mechanism is arranged on the base and is in transmission connection with the swing mechanism; and the polishing mechanism is in transmission connection with the swing mechanism. The intelligent polishing machine based on the internet of things is controlled by the center control mechanism, and the intelligent degree is increased. A second power shaft is driven to rotate by a third motor, so that four fixing blocks are independently driven to move along a chute, a to-be-polished object is fixed by the slide block, objects with irregular shapes can be fixed, and the firmness can be improved. A first power shaft is driven by a second motor, the lifting block is driven to move up and down along the supporting post, the polishing mechanism is driven to flexibly move by a first connecting rod, a second connecting rod, a third connecting rod and a U-shaped fixing rod, the flexibility of the polishing machine is improved, and the physical output of an operator is reduced.

Background technology
Polishing machine is also referred to as grinder, drives polishing disk to rotate at a high speed by motor, polishing disk is entered with surface to be thrown Row friction, and then depollution, oxide layer, the purpose of shallow trace are can reach, it is commonly used as mechanical polishing, polishing and waxes.
The polishing machine that we commonly use is generally fixed or hand-held, when operation is polished, needs staff Hold and treat parabolic or polishing machine, angle is changed by manpower, so as to the not coplanar for treating parabolic is polished, so not only operate Person wants costly muscle power, and operate it is extremely dumb, moreover, if treating that parabolic is not fixed, polishing when Wait, object receiving force is rolled or toppled over, not only result in discontinuity, affect polishing effect, also there is certain danger.
